In nature, the recycling of carbon and nitrogen occurs through various processes. Carbon is cycled through photosynthesis, respiration, and decomposition. Nitrogen is cycled through nitrogen fixation by bacteria, uptake by plants, consumption by animals, decomposition, and denitrification. These cycles ensure that carbon and nitrogen are continuously reused by organisms in the ecosystem.

Carbon is recycled in nature through processes like photosynthesis, respiration, decomposition, and combustion. During photosynthesis, plants convert carbon dioxide into organic compounds while releasing oxygen. When organisms respire, they release carbon dioxide back into the atmosphere. Decomposers break down organic matter, returning carbon to the soil. Combustion, such as wildfires, releases carbon stored in vegetation back into the atmosphere.
